I'm working on an audio CD that helps small biz owners get the right MINDSET where marketing is concerned.

It's a real CD (not digital) -- 1-hour long.

If I JV with the right people, how many of these could I realistically sell within one month of launch?

I'm thinking $17 -- I get 50% -- JV's get 50%.

Or, put another way, how long might it take to sell 800 of 'em?

Note: I would be proactive in trying to get JV partners, not just leave it to clickbank or similar (yes, I know they only do digital products any way (?)).

Here's a TIP;
Something that has worked for me back in the Ol' days before the Internet and even CD's.

I'd sell a low-priced Intro Program for $49 to business people then, because I could only get 1.4 megs onto a Floppy....I'd put a "Back-End" program on the Floppy I sent to my customers and in the Material was a Sales Letter that spelled out the benefits of my "UpGrade" program....then...at the close of the Letter I mentioned that...."They ALREADY have the Material I'm selling! It's ON the Floppy...BUT, it's encrypted, they ALREADY have it in their hot little hands.... and...to UNLOCK it, they had to call me with their Credit Card info to get the Secret Password.

This "Marketing Tecnique" helped me sell LOTS of "Back-end" programs.

I those days (Just 12 yrs ago) I had to use special Compression Programs to get the bytes onto a 1.4meg Floppy. Nowadays a CD can hold 650 or more megs. Plenty of space for most Back-End programs.

I don't think there's anything more irresistible than knowing you have something in your greedy little hands but you can't "have" it until you do one more thing...

namely, spend more money

I especially like this quote from your message...

{He told me many times, "If you have something worthwhile to sell, then, don't give it away, CHARGE for it! Get what it's WORTH!"

Peter's now very comfortable.}

and the fact that you charged 50$ for an intro product.

How quickly we think we need to lower prices, yet the same people were selling to are spending $100's at a time shopping for themselves or their kids at places like american eagle

Speaking of american eagle - they're getting $20 for a lewd, grubby, plain ol teeshirt cause kids are willing and wanting to pay that much for it.

Think about that (I will too) before you think you need to bump down the price. Instead, add a few things to the product, turn it into a system or hell, a mini-system and RAISE the price...
